What Rhinoplasty Surgery Can Address
Rhinoplasty is a surgical procedure designed to reshape the nose, improve nasofacial proportions, or improve nasal function. Because the nose plays a central role in facial harmony as well as breathing, even small changes can have a meaningful impact. During a rhinoplasty consultation, the surgeon evaluates nasal anatomy, facial features, and functional concerns to determine whether surgical rhinoplasty is appropriate and which techniques may be most effective. A rhinoplasty procedure may address:
- Cosmetic concerns such as a crooked nose, dorsal hump, nasal tip asymmetry or imbalance
- Structural issues disrupting nasal airflow and breathing
- Changes related to prior injury, surgery, or other reconstructive needs

Breathing Improvements Through Functional Rhinoplasty
Functional rhinoplasty addresses nasal function issues, often related to structural concerns such as a deviated septum or nasal valve collapse. By improving airflow, this approach can enhance nasal breathing while also supporting aesthetic goals when combined with cosmetic nasal surgery.

Final Result Timeline
Patients can expect:
- Early improvements within several weeks
- Continued refinement over several months
- Final nasal contours continuing to refine for up to one year
